“Made in NY” Post Production Training Program Information Session
When: Thursday, April 19 from 12:00-2:00 PM
Where: Brooklyn Navy Yard, Building 92
Join the thriving TV & Film Post Production Industry. The training begins on May 9, 2018.
Requirements
- No RSVP is required to attend an information session
- Arrive on-time: Latecomers will not be admitted
- Be prepared to stay for at least two hours
- 21+ years of age | 6 months NYC residency
- Strong computer skills
- 6 months experience in Production Industry as Office/Set PA
- 2 year commitment to working in Post Industry
BWI serves individuals from low-income backgrounds, who are unemployed or under-employed. We welcome all interested applicants to the “Made in NY” Post Production Training Program, and those who currently or recently experienced serious challenges finding or maintaining employment will be prioritized for enrollment.
When: April 18 | 11AM Sharp
Where: Red Hook Initiative (767 Hicks Street Brooklyn, NY)
This free pre-apprenticeship program will lead to industry certifications and support in accessing paid apprenticeship positions with Roofer’s Union Local 8.
Career-path opportunities with excellent pay and benefits will follow for qualified graduates!
Participants will obtain instruction in:
- 70 Hours of Roofing Instruction
- OSHA 30 Certification
- 16-hour Scaffolding Certification
- Solar Panel Installation
- Construction Math and Measurement
- Tool Usage
Minimum requirements: Must be at least 18 years old, a Red Hook or Gowanus NYCHA resident, completed the 10th grade (transcript required), pass a reading and math test, pass a drug test (requirement of the Roofers Union Local 8), and be comfortable with extreme heights.
BROOKLYN WOODS INFORMATION SESSION
When: April 18, 2018 | 10am-12pm
Where: 125 8th Street, Brooklyn (2nd Floor)
Brooklyn Woods offers five cycles per year and recruits for the next training cycle on a rolling basis. You do not need to pre-register to attend. Recruiting for May 14-June 29 Training Cycle
At the Information Session, you will fill out an application with your work history, get detailed information about the program, take a tour of the shop and take a reading, math and measurement test.
- Please bring a valid photo ID and a resume, if you have one.
- Please note that latecomers who arrive after 10 AM may not be admitted.
Brooklyn Woods is located at the BWI Sector Skills Center at 125 8th Street, between 2nd Avenue and 3rd Avenue in Gowanus, Brooklyn.
